    The 2016 Ford Explorer Base Engine features a 3.5-liter V6 that delivers solid performance and efficiency. With 290 horsepower and 255 lb-ft of torque, it balances power and fuel economy for everyday driving needs.

    2016 Ford Explorer V6 Engine Performance Details

    The 2016 Ford Explorer Base Engine is equipped with a 3.5-liter V6 engine, which is a popular choice among SUV enthusiasts. This engine is designed to provide a blend of power and efficiency, making it suitable for both city and highway driving. The engine’s output of 290 horsepower ensures that the vehicle can handle various driving conditions, while the 255 lb-ft of torque allows for smooth acceleration and towing capabilities.

    Specification Value
    Engine Type 3.5L V6
    Horsepower 290 hp
    Torque 255 lb-ft
    Fuel Economy (City) 17 mpg
    Fuel Economy (Highway) 24 mpg

    2016 Ford Explorer Base Engine Fuel Economy Ratings

    Fuel efficiency is a critical factor for many SUV buyers. The 2016 Ford Explorer Base Engine achieves an estimated 17 mpg in the city and 24 mpg on the highway. This efficiency is competitive for its class, making it an appealing option for families and daily commuters alike.

    The engine features a six-speed automatic transmission, which contributes to its overall fuel economy. Drivers can expect a smooth driving experience, whether navigating through urban settings or cruising on the highway.

    2016 Ford Explorer Base Engine Towing Specs

    Towing capacity is another important consideration for SUV owners. The 2016 Ford Explorer, equipped with the Base Engine, can tow up to 5,000 pounds when properly equipped. This capability makes it suitable for towing boats, trailers, or other recreational equipment.

    The vehicle’s payload capacity is also noteworthy. With a maximum payload of around 1,500 pounds, it can accommodate family gear, luggage, or other cargo without compromising performance.

    2016 Ford Explorer Handling and Suspension Performance

    The driving experience of the 2016 Ford Explorer is enhanced by its well-tuned suspension and steering system. The vehicle offers a comfortable ride, with minimal body roll during cornering. This stability is particularly beneficial for families who prioritize safety and comfort.

    The Explorer’s all-wheel-drive option provides added traction and control, especially in adverse weather conditions. This feature is essential for those living in areas with snow or heavy rain.
